Abstract

The internet of things (IoT) is a huge network of heterogeneous devices; sensors and actuators, which provide a better world of services such as smart cities, smart grid, health care, smart agriculture and so on. This novel concept represents a rich area of research challenges. Instead, the most important aspects of the IoT networks are security and privacy. Because of the potential augmentation of IoT devices number and their limitations in terms of computational power, energy and memory, those aspects become more and more difficult to be established. This chapter consists of an exhaustive study about IoT applications and security in such environment. Hence, we present IoT deployment issues and the existent attacks on IoT environment considering the IoT layers. Then, we discuss the requirement of IoT security as well as the actual solutions for remediation of the compromised security, such as authentication protocols, intrusion detection systems and machine learning.
